Ajout de sudo en passwordless
This commit is contained in:
@@ -1,5 +1,4 @@
|
|||||||
---
|
---
|
||||||
|
|
||||||
- name: Load variables
|
- name: Load variables
|
||||||
include_vars: "{{ ansible_os_family|lower }}.yml"
|
include_vars: "{{ ansible_os_family|lower }}.yml"
|
||||||
|
|
||||||
@@ -50,6 +49,16 @@
|
|||||||
group: root
|
group: root
|
||||||
mode: 0640
|
mode: 0640
|
||||||
|
|
||||||
|
- name: Linux | Install sudoers file for sudo group
|
||||||
|
ansible.builtin.template:
|
||||||
|
src: sudo_sudoers
|
||||||
|
dest: "/etc/sudoers.d/sudo"
|
||||||
|
backup: yes
|
||||||
|
owner: root
|
||||||
|
group: root
|
||||||
|
mode: 0640
|
||||||
|
validate: /usr/sbin/visudo -cf %s
|
||||||
|
|
||||||
- name: Linux | Define MOTD file
|
- name: Linux | Define MOTD file
|
||||||
ansible.builtin.shell:
|
ansible.builtin.shell:
|
||||||
cmd: figlet -t {{ inventory_hostname_short | quote }} > /etc/motd
|
cmd: figlet -t {{ inventory_hostname_short | quote }} > /etc/motd
|
||||||
|
|||||||
@@ -0,0 +1,2 @@
|
|||||||
|
# Enable passwordless sudo for sudo members
|
||||||
|
%sudo ALL=(ALL) NOPASSWD: ALL
|
||||||
@@ -1,5 +1,5 @@
|
|||||||
---
|
---
|
||||||
|
## Define custom UIDs to avoid conflicts
|
||||||
user_details:
|
user_details:
|
||||||
- { name: vinishor, uid: 2000 }
|
- { name: vinishor, uid: 2000 }
|
||||||
- { name: mirsal, uid: 2001 }
|
- { name: mirsal, uid: 2001 }
|
||||||
|
|||||||
Reference in New Issue
Block a user